NTT DOCOMO Chooses SOC's H.264 8K Video Encoder for its World's First 360° 8K VR Live Video Streaming/Viewing System

Nov-27-2018

System-On-Chip (SOC) Technologies is proud to announce that SOC’s super-low-latency H.264 8K video encoding solution was chosen by NTT DOCOMO, INC. for its World's First 360-degree 8K VR Live Video Streaming and Viewing System. The system comprises of equipment that stitches together five 4K fisheye videos from five outward-facing cameras in real time at 30fps, an 8K H.264 encoder for real-time compression, the real-time Panorama Cho Engine encoder to divide the 360° 8K video into multi-direction tiles and a server to transmit tiles according to the user's viewing direction.
